>I've been working on setting up a test box as I'm hoping to migrate from a
>sendmail/majordomo/uw-imap sytem to a postfix/mailman/cyrus-imap system.
>
>I've got postfix installed and using cyrus-imap for local delivery.  It
>appears to be working correctly (I can send and receive e-mail both local
>to the test server and from other boxes on the internet).
>

You need to tell postfix to use /etc/aliases file for forwarding
messages and then put the lines that mailman tells you when it creates
the list into the /etc/aliases file and run newaliases.

It took me ages to realise, because the documentation doesn't tell
you, that mail never gets delivered to cyrus-imap.  The lines in the
aliases file pipes the mail into a wrapper program
